About Gusto
Gusto simplifies payroll by calculating, filing, and paying federal, state, and local taxes automatically. The platform supports unlimited payroll runs, multiple pay schedules, and direct deposit. Beyond payroll, Gusto offers employee benefits including health insurance, 401(k), FSA, and commuter benefits through an integrated marketplace. Its HR tools include onboarding workflows, time tracking, PTO management, and an employee self-service portal. Gusto is US-only and particularly strong for businesses with 1-500 employees that want a single platform for HR and payroll. Integration with popular accounting software like QuickBooks and Xero keeps the books in sync.

Pros & Cons
Pros
- • Tax filing is genuinely fully automated — zero manual work
- • Benefits marketplace makes offering health insurance accessible to small businesses
- • Clean, intuitive interface that employees actually like using
- • Strong compliance tooling for multi-state payroll
Cons
- • US-only — no international payroll support
- • Per-employee pricing adds up quickly for growing teams
- • Customer support can be slow during peak tax periods
- • Benefits administration limited to certain US states
